- Brady GardnerJun 06, 2022 · 3 years agoOne way to securely use a 3rd party payment service to purchase digital currencies is to choose a reputable and trusted payment service provider. Look for payment services that have a strong track record in the industry and have implemented robust security measures to protect user transactions. Additionally, make sure to enable two-factor authentication (2FA) for your payment service account to add an extra layer of security. This will require you to provide a second form of verification, such as a unique code sent to your mobile device, in addition to your password when logging in or making transactions. By using a trusted payment service provider and enabling 2FA, you can enhance the security of your transactions and minimize the risk of unauthorized access to your digital currencies.
- Rudrik BhattFeb 23, 2021 · 4 years agoWhen using a 3rd party payment service to purchase digital currencies, it is important to be cautious and vigilant. Before making any transactions, thoroughly research the payment service provider to ensure they have a good reputation and a history of secure transactions. Read reviews and check for any security incidents or breaches in the past. Additionally, make sure to use a strong and unique password for your payment service account and avoid sharing it with anyone. Regularly monitor your account for any suspicious activity and report any unauthorized transactions immediately. By being proactive and taking necessary precautions, you can securely use a 3rd party payment service to purchase digital currencies.
